AMD's AI chip deals with OpenAI, Meta offer deep discounts: report

SemiAnalysis suggests that AMD's warrant deals with OpenAI and Meta are not merely equity sweeteners but function more like substantial rebates on compute costs. These warrants, which vest based on AMD's stock price reaching up to $600 and can be exercised for a nominal fee, could offer discounts ranging from 85% to 105% for OpenAI. This structure effectively means AMD might be paying customers to take their hardware, a strategy that could be beneficial if it drives significant volume and increases AMD's stock price, which has already seen gains due to AI accelerator demand.
